A Sampling of Numerical Techniques

This paper is meant to be an introduction to the study of numerical analysis. We explore a sampling of numerical techniques used to address several elementary, yet fundamental queries, such as finding roots to continuous real-valued functions and solving linear systems of the form Ax = b. We approach these problems from a numerical perspective, describing the algorithms we use.
